CodeGym /Blog Java /Random-FR /Comment obtenir un caractère de nouvelle ligne en Java ?
Auteur
Artem Divertitto
Senior Android Developer at United Tech

Comment obtenir un caractère de nouvelle ligne en Java ?

Publié dans le groupe Random-FR

Quels sont les caractères de nouvelle ligne en Java ?

Les caractères réservés "\n" ou "\r\n" en Java sont appelés les caractères de saut de ligne.
En Java, des mots clés sont alloués pour exécuter des fonctions spécifiques. Par exemple, l'utilisation du mot clé « int » fera du type de données d'une variable un entier . De même, en utilisant " \n " ou " \r\n " lors de l'impression d'une chaîne en Java, une " barre oblique inverse n " ne sera pas imprimée. Au lieu de cela, un nouveau saut de ligne sera imprimé sur la console.

Qu'est-ce que "\n" affiche en Java?

Regardons un exemple d'impression de "\n" sur la console.

Exemple


public class NewLineChar {
	public static void main(String[] args) {

		System.out.println("Hi, I am Sponge Bob.\nI just signed up at Code Gym.\nI love the Java learning experience here so far!");
	}
}

Sortir

Salut, je suis Bob l'éponge. Je viens de m'inscrire au Code Gym. J'adore l'expérience d'apprentissage de Java ici jusqu'à présent !

Comment ajouter un caractère de nouvelle ligne à une chaîne ?

Il existe plusieurs façons d'ajouter le caractère de nouvelle ligne à une chaîne. Vous pouvez utiliser « \n » ou « \r\n » pour ajouter un saut de ligne dans un paragraphe continu. Examinons quelques façons de le faire.

Exemple


public class NewLineChar {
	public static void main(String[] args) {

		// Method 1: newline after every sentence
		String sentence1 = "What a beautiful day to be alive!";
		String sentence2 = "Let's be thankful for all the blessings we've been showered with.";
		String sentence3 = "It only makes sense to be helpful, cooperative and generous to those who are less fortunate.";

		// without newline after each sentence
		System.out.println("-------Printing without newline character--------");
		System.out.println(sentence1 + sentence2 + sentence3);

		// newline character after each sentence
		System.out.println("\n-------Printing with newline character-----------");
		System.out.println(sentence1 + "\n" + sentence2 + "\n" + sentence3);

		// Method 2: new line after each paragraph
		String paragraph1 = "Java is the most dynamic and easy to plug and play language. It has been transforming lives for more than 2 decades now. It still continues to grow to date.";
		String paragraph2 = "If you're a beginner who wants to be a professional in Java, you need to focus on targeted learning with consistent practice. If you're looking for a responsive community to grow with, then Code Gym is the way to go!";

		// without newline after each paragraph
		System.out.println("\n-------Printing without newline character--------");
		System.out.println(paragraph1 + paragraph2);

		// new line character after each paragraph
		System.out.println("\n-------Printing with newline character-----------");
		System.out.println(paragraph1 + "\r\n" + paragraph2);
	}
}

Sortir

-------Impression sans caractère de nouvelle ligne-------- Quelle belle journée pour être en vie ! Soyons reconnaissants pour toutes les bénédictions dont nous avons été comblés. Il est logique d'être utile, coopératif et généreux envers ceux qui ont moins de chance. -------Impression avec caractère de saut de ligne----------- Quelle belle journée pour être en vie ! Soyons reconnaissants pour toutes les bénédictions dont nous avons été comblés. Il est logique d'être utile, coopératif et généreux envers ceux qui sont moins fortunés. -------Impression sans caractère de retour à la ligne-------- Java est le langage plug and play le plus dynamique et le plus facile à utiliser. Il transforme des vies depuis plus de 2 décennies maintenant. Il continue de croître à ce jour. Si vous êtes un débutant qui souhaite devenir un professionnel de Java, vous devez vous concentrer sur un apprentissage ciblé avec une pratique cohérente. Si tu' Si vous êtes à la recherche d'une communauté réactive avec laquelle grandir, alors Code Gym est la voie à suivre ! -------Imprimer avec un caractère de retour à la ligne----------- Java est le langage plug and play le plus dynamique et le plus facile à utiliser. Il transforme des vies depuis plus de 2 décennies maintenant. Il continue de croître à ce jour. Si vous êtes un débutant qui souhaite devenir un professionnel de Java, vous devez vous concentrer sur un apprentissage ciblé avec une pratique constante. Si vous recherchez une communauté réactive avec laquelle grandir, alors Code Gym est la solution !

Conclusion

Vous devriez maintenant être à l'aise avec l'utilisation des caractères de retour à la ligne en Java. Pour une maîtrise plus approfondie du sujet, nous vous conseillons de continuer à vous entraîner avec les caractères de retour à la ligne dans Strings en Java. Bonne chance et bon apprentissage !
Commentaires
TO VIEW ALL COMMENTS OR TO MAKE A COMMENT,
GO TO FULL VERSION